The accumulation distribution (A/D) indicator shows the degree to which American Shipping is accumulated by the market over a given period. It uses the quote sensitivity to the highest or lowest daily price of American Shipping to determine if accumulation or reduction is taking place in the market. This value is adjusted by American Shipping trading volume to give more weight to distributions with higher volume over lower volume.

Accumulation distribution indicator can signal that a trend is either nearing completion, at a continuation, or is about to break-outs. The actual value of this indicator is of no significance. What is significant is the change in value of over time. The formula for A/D of a given trading day can be expressed as follow: ((Close - Low) - (High - Close)) / (High - Low) X Volume

One of the popular trading techniques among algorithmic traders is to use market-neutral strategies where every trade hedges away some risk. Because there are two separate transactions required, even if one position performs unexpectedly, the other equity can make up some of the losses. If you are still planning to invest in American Shipping check if it may still be traded through OTC markets such as Pink Sheets or OTC Bulletin Board. You may also purchase it directly from the company, but this is not always possible and may require contacting the company directly. Please note that delisted stocks are often considered to be more risky investments, as they are no longer subject to the same regulatory and reporting requirements as listed stocks. Therefore, it is essential to carefully research the American Shipping's history and understand the potential risks before investing.
